Episode #2
This episode explores the systems neuroscience behind tinnitus and presents research on how noise-induced hearing loss alters spontaneous activity patterns in the auditory cortex, based on animal studies.
Sven Vanneste
What is buzzing? The systems neuroscience of tinnitus
Arnaud Noreña
Changes in the spatio-temporal pattern of spontaneous activity in the auditory cortex of guinea pig after noice-induced hearing loss
